Output 665af36244f93da8ccd977d1b7799edf6fa51372fc75bb1ba711e6e495a9a48e:0

value
5615834939
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ae6a7f4d2e35d1d0e379bed965478e030db5f35f28d861384fac8f78fbb4864
address
tb1p8tn20axjudw36r3hn0kev4rcuqcdkhe472xcvyuylty00ramfpjqxn340w
transaction
665af36244f93da8ccd977d1b7799edf6fa51372fc75bb1ba711e6e495a9a48e
confirmations
68787
spent
true